Surprise! Compliance has growing role in business decisions
A new survey of general counsels and compliance officers found that 30% of companies in North America, Europe, and Asia stopped doing business with a partner because of corruption risks.
The survey results published this week by FCPA Blog-sponsor AlixPartners found that Africa and Russia are perceived as the areas representing the greatest risk.… Continue Reading